Output 95ca4165eddf4fa81244c6565ec3427e1d59c97e31841d206219654a64fd2930:1

value
31229099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ac29ed3fcbc8d710bc0913a936429a48b31fc46 OP_EQUAL
address
3JiWkgsPTyDrYhQEi8CDjLCLBVvoH5cm2i
transaction
95ca4165eddf4fa81244c6565ec3427e1d59c97e31841d206219654a64fd2930
spent
true